问财量化选股策略逻辑
根据提供的信息,该选股策略的主要逻辑包括:
- 换手率大于7%但小于10%
- 超大单净流入最多的股票
- 收盘价>=20日均线
以上三个条件分别对应了市场活跃度、主力资金流向和股价趋势等基本面因素,可以帮助投资者筛选出可能具有投资价值的股票。
选股逻辑分析
从理论上讲,这三种条件本身并不直接构成一个有效的买入信号,因为它们并不能确定一只股票未来的走势。然而,如果将这三个条件结合在一起使用,可能会提高选股的成功率。
例如,如果一只股票在换手率达到较高水平的同时,又有大量的超大单流入,并且其收盘价高于20日均线,那么这只股票可能是市场热门股或者主力看好股,因此投资者可能会更加关注它。
然而,这也存在一定的风险。首先,如果这三个条件同时满足,可能意味着市场的整体热度较高,但并不代表所有的股票都会上涨。其次,主力资金流入可能并不是基于对公司真实业绩的认可,而是为了进行炒作或者洗盘操作。最后,20日均线只是一个简单的移动平均线,不能完全反映股票的价格趋势。
如何优化?
为了进一步优化这个策略,投资者可以考虑以下几点:
- 对于换手率,可以考虑增加一些过滤条件,比如只选择在最近一个月内换手率增长较快的股票。
- 对于超大单净流入,可以考虑增加一些其他的指标,比如追踪全天的资金流入流出情况,而不是仅仅关注某一时间段的流入。
- 对于20日均线,可以考虑引入更多的技术指标,比如MACD、KDJ等,来综合判断价格趋势。
最终的选股逻辑
在满足上述所有条件的情况下,投资者可以选择这些股票进行交易。
常见问题
Q: 如果某只股票同时满足了换手率、超大单净流入和收盘价高于20日均线这三个条件,那么我是否应该立即买入?
A: 不是的,虽然这三种条件可以作为一个基本的买入信号,但并不能保证这只股票一定会涨。投资者还需要结合公司的基本面、行业趋势等因素来进行综合判断。
python代码参考
import pandas as pd
import talib
# 获取股票数据
df = pd.read_csv('stock_data.csv')
# 筛选符合条件的股票
selected_stocks = df[(df['
## 如何进行量化策略实盘?
请把您优化好的选股语句放入文章最下面模板的选股语句中即可。
select_sentence = '市值小于100亿' #选股语句。
模板如何使用?
点击页面下方的复制按钮,复制到自己的账户即可使用模板进行回测。